Stephen Colbert will not break character on The Colbert Report—not even for James Franco—but he will do it to give solid fatherly advice to teenage girls.

The real-life Colbert just made a very sincere appearance on Rookie Mag's "Ask a Grown Man" series, where he answered questions about harassment, dating, and dealing with parents.

It's no secret that IRL Colbert is more mature than his Comedy Central counterpart—the man gives good commencement speech—but seeing him in grown man mode is so touching that you'll almost want to forgive him for retiring his idiot pundit character. And wish he could legally adopt you.

"Stephen Colbert" is dead. Long live Stephen Colbert.
